freemarker
icecoola_
这个作者很懒,什么都没留下…
展开
-
freemarker渲染_非空判断_弹窗显示
[#if aa.bb??] [#if aa.bb.cc??] class="btn btn-icon" name="btnShow" id="btnShow"> XXX [/#if] [/#if]$("#btnShow").click(function(){ var id = "no"; [#if aa.bb?? && aa.bb.cc原创 2018-02-05 09:49:06 · 2182 阅读 · 0 评论 -
FreeMarker对null值的处理
FreeMarker对null值的处理!对输出的空值做处理,只输出无返回值输出name的值:${name}。如果name为null,就会报错。输出name的值:${name!}。如果name为null,就不会报错,什么也没输出。(重点)输出name的值:${name!"默认值"}。如果name为null,就输出”默认值”字符串。(重点)输转载 2018-02-05 10:45:16 · 752 阅读 · 0 评论 -
FreeMarker日期处理
当变量类型是 java.sql.Date java.sql.Time java.sql.Timestamp 时,可以不用指定格式; @Temporal(TemporalType.DATE) 注解让ORM框架在从数据库中取出数据后将 java.util.Date 类型自动转换成了 java.sql.Date 类型,这时FreeMarker会自动识别其格式。${testDate?da...原创 2018-04-19 18:42:31 · 1420 阅读 · 0 评论 -
Freemarker 基本数据类型
Freemarker 基本数据类型一 数据类型简介 freemarker 模板中的数据类型由如下几种: 1. 布尔型:等价于java中的boolean类型, 不同的是不能直接输出,可以转换成字符串再输出 2. 日期型:等价于java中的Date类型, 不同之处在于不能直接输出,需要转换成字符串再输出 3. 数值型:等价于java 中的int...转载 2018-04-19 18:49:08 · 1517 阅读 · 0 评论 -
Freemarker_字符串类型数字格式化
问题描述: 之前一直是用下面方式,进行数字格式化,然而这次出错了${price?string(',##0.00')}问题原因: 所要格式化的数据的数据类型有关系: 之前一直是double类型,这次的是String类型的数字了.. 用下的方式先进行类型转换,再进行格式化${price?number?string(',##0.00')}...原创 2018-08-15 10:54:39 · 4899 阅读 · 1 评论 -
Freemarker_textarea文本框显示$bnsp;
问题描述: 从数据库去除带有 $bnsp: 的数据,会被前台自动给转义显示了问题处理:<textarea name="content" id="content" style="width:600px;height:800px;"> ${item.content?replace('&','&amp;')} </textarea>..原创 2018-08-16 16:09:22 · 1634 阅读 · 0 评论